发那科加工中心对刀在G18G19铣圆弧

数控铣床及加工中心编程与应用 - 搜狗百科
&&历史版本
数控铣床及加工中心编程与应用
该版本已锁定
《数控铣床及加工中心编程与应用》是根据教育部数控技术应用专业技能型紧缺人才培养方案和劳动与社会保障部制定的有关国家职业标准及相关职业技能鉴定规范编写的。《数控铣床及加工中心编程与应用》共分10章,讲述了数控铣床与加工中心基本知识、数控加工工艺、数控编程基础、数控铣床及加工中心编程、宏程序、数控铣床及加工中心操作、数控铣削加工实训课题、知识技能考核模拟题,并且列举了大量典型实例。全书吸取了项目式教学法等先进经验,采用课题形式,将理论与实践充分结合起来,有利于培养学生的实际操作能力和应用能力。
   书 名: 及加工中心编程与应用  作 者:耿国卿  :   出版时间: 2009年01月  : 6  开本: 16开  定价: 30元
  《数控铣床及加工中心编程与应用》是根据教育部数控技术应用专业技能型紧缺方案和劳动与社会保障部制定的有关及相关规范编写的。《数控铣床及加工中心编程与应用》共分10章,讲述了数控铣床与加工中心基本知识、、基础、数控铣床及加工中心编程、宏程序、数控铣床及加工中心操作、数控铣削加工实训课题、知识技能考核模拟题,并且列举了大量典型实例。全书吸取了项目式等先进经验,采用课题形式,将理论与实践充分结合起来,有利于培养学生的实际操作能力和应用能力。《数控铣床及加工中心编程与应用》可作为高等职业院校、、成人院校数控技术应用专业、机电专业、模具专业的教材,也可作为数控铣床及培训教材,并可供有关工程技术人员参考。
  第一章数控铣床与加工中心概述  第二章数控加工工艺  第三章数控编程基础   第四章数控铣床及加工中心编程  第五章宏程序  第六章FANUC 0i?MB系统数控铣床及加工中心操作  第七章华中(HNC?21/22M)系统数控铣床及加工中心操作  第八章 802D系统数控铣床及加工中心编程与操作  第九章数控铣削加工实训课题  第十章知识技能考核模拟题  参考文献  ……
《数控铣床及加工中心编程与应用》可作为高等职业院校、中等职业学校、成人院校数控技术应用专业、机电专业、模具专业的教材,也可作为数控铣床及加工中心编程与操作培训教材,并可供机械制造业有关工程技术人员参考。
第一章 数控铣床与加工中心概述 第一节 数控铣床与加工中心的概念和分类 一、数控铣床 二、加工中心 三、数控铣床与加工中心分类 四、数控铣床与加工中心结构 第二节 加工中心刀库形式与自动换刀装置 一、加工中心的刀库形式 二、自动换刀装置(ATC)与换刀过程 三、刀具的选用与识别 第三节 数控系统简介 一、数控系统的功能 二、数控系统的工作过程 三、数控系统的分类 四、数控系统发展概况 复习思考题
第二章 数控加工工艺 第一节 数控铣床与加工中心加工对象 一、数控铣床与加工中心的加工范围 二、数控铣床的加工对象 三、加工中心的加工对象 第二节 数控铣床与加工中心刀具 一、加工中心的刀柄 二、常用刀具的装夹 三、数控刀具类型及工艺特点 第三节 数控加工常用工量具 一、数控铣床与加工中心常用工具 二、常用量具 第四节 工件的装夹和定位 一、工件的装夹方式 二、工件定位基本原理 三、定位基准的选择 第五节 数控机床夹具 一、机床夹具的分类 二、数控机床夹具特点 三、数控机床常用夹具及装夹方法 第六节 数控加工方法与切削用量选择 一、铣削加工 二、钻孔 三、铰孔 四、镗孔 五、螺纹加工 第七节 加工余量及工序尺寸的确定 一、加工余量与工序尺寸 二、工艺尺寸链 复习思考题
第三章 数控编程基础 第一节 数控编程的方法 一、手工编程 二、自动编程 第二节 数控机床的坐标系 一、标准坐标系 二、机床坐标系 三、工件坐标系 第三节 数控程序的结构 第四节 数控机床的基本功能指令 一、准备功能(G功能) 二、辅助功能(M功能) 三、刀具功能(T功能) 四、主轴功能(S功能) 五、进给功能(F功能) 第五节 数控编程的坐标尺寸指令 一、坐标平面选择指令(G17/G18/G19) 二、绝对值指令(G90)与增量值指令(G91) 三、自动返回参考点 第六节 坐标系设定 一、机床坐标系(G53) 二、工件坐标系设定(G92、G54~G59) 复习思考题
第四章 数控铣床及加工中心编程 第一节 插补功能指令 一、快速定位G00 二、直线插补G01 三、圆弧插补G02、G03 四、螺旋插补G02、G03 第二节 刀具补偿功能 一、刀具长度补偿G43、G44、G49 二、刀具半径补偿G40、G41、G42 第三节 固定循环指令 一、固定循环指令格式及说明 二、循环指令加工方式及应用 三、使用固定循环功能注意事项 第四节 子程序 第五节 镜像加工指令 第六节 坐标旋转指令 第七节 比例缩放指令 第八节 极坐标指令 第九节 四轴加工编程 复习思考题
第五章 宏程序 第一节 宏程序的概念及特点 一、宏程序的概念 二、宏程序的特点 第二节 FANUC系统的宏变量 一、变量 二、运算指令 三、转移与循环指令 第三节 FANUC系统的宏程序调用 一、宏程序调用指令 二、自变量赋值 第四节 华中(HNC?21/22M)系统的宏程序 一、宏变量及常量 二、运算符与表达式 三、赋值语句 四、条件判别语句IF,ELSE,ENDIF 五、循环语句WHILE,ENDW 第五节 宏程序的编制与应用 一、圆 二、椭圆 三、双曲线 四、抛物线 五、四轴宏程序编程实例 复习思考题
第六章 FANUC 0i?MB系统数控铣床及加工中心操作 第一节 数控铣床与加工中心操作安全规程 一、数控机床安全操作规程 二、数控机床维护与保养 第二节 FANUC 0i Mate?MB数控系统操作面板及功能 一、CRT显示屏/MDI面板各键的功用 二、机床控制面板各键的功用 第三节 数控机床基本操作 一、开机 二、关机 三、回参考点 四、手动方式 五、手轮方式 六、MDI方式 七、编辑方式 八、自动方式 九、选择程序 十、删除一个程序 十一、删除全部程序 十二、手工装卸刀具 十三、自动换刀 第四节 数控铣床与加工中心的对刀 一、试切法对刀 二、寻边器对刀 三、Z轴设定器对刀 四、百分表对刀 第五节 程序传输格式和DNC传输软件 一、串口线路的连接 二、程序传输格式 三、传输软件介绍及操作 复习思考题
第七章 华中(HNC?21/22M)系统数控铣床及加工中心操作 第一节 华中(HNC?21/22M)系统操作面板及各键功能 一、MDI面板各键的功用 二、机床操作按键及功用 三、功能软键及功用 第二节 华中(HNC?21/22M)系统基本操作 一、开机 二、关机 三、回参考点 四、手动操作 五、手摇操作 六、手动换刀 七、MDI操作 八、调用已有程序 九、编辑新程序 十、对刀 第三节 华中(HNC?21/22M)系统指令 一、华中(HNC?21/22M)系统程序的格式 二、华中(HNC?21/22M)系统辅助功能指令 三、华中(HNC?21/22M)系统准备功能指令 四、进给控制指令 五、回参考点指令 六、刀具补偿功能指令 七、简化编程指令 八、固定循环指令 复习思考题
第八章 SIEMENS 802D系统数控铣床及加工中心编程与操作 第一节 SIEMENS 802D系统功能 一、准备功能代码 二、固定循环功能代码 三、辅助功能代码 四、其他功能F、S、T、D代码 五、常用字符集和运算符号 第二节 SIEMENS 802D系统基本编程指令 一、NC编程基本结构 二、常用指令 第三节 刀具补偿功能指令 一、刀具选择指令T 二、刀具补偿号指令D 三、刀具半径补偿指令G41、G42、G40 四、使用刀具半径补偿注意事项 五、刀具半径补偿的作用 第四节 固定循环功能指令 一、CYCLE82编程格式 二、排孔HOLES1编程格式 三、圆周孔HOLES2编程格式 四、铣模式圆弧槽SLOT1编程格式 五、铣槽式圆周槽SLOT2编程格式 第五节 蓝图编程 一、蓝图编程简介 二、蓝图编程实例 第六节 子程序的调用 一、子程序概述 二、子程序的调用 三、调用加工循环 四、模态调用子程序 第七节 编程实例 第八节 SIEMENS 802D数控铣床及加工中心操作 一、数控铣床、加工中心面板简介 二、数控铣床与加工中心基本操作 复习思考题
第九章 数控铣削加工实训课题 课题1 平面铣削加工 课题2 平面内轮廓铣削加工 课题3 凸台零件的铣削加工 课题4 槽形零件的铣削加工 课题5 沟槽铣削加工 课题6 钻孔加工 课题7 孔系零件的加工 课题8 铰孔加工 课题9 孔的铣削加工 课题10 镗孔加工 课题11 攻内螺纹 课题12 螺纹铣削加工
第十章 知识技能考核模拟题 知识技能考核模拟试题一 知识技能考核模拟试题二 知识技能考核模拟试题三 知识技能考核模拟试题四 参考文献
本书是根据教育部数控技术应用专业技能型紧缺人才培养方案和劳动与社会保障部制定的有关国家职业标准及相关职业技能鉴定规范编写的。随着机电一体化技术的迅猛发展,数控机床已日趋普及,我国现已成为世界上数控机床的消费大国和生产大国,国民经济各行各业需要大量的数控机床的开发人才和应用人才。为了适应我国高等职业技术教育发展以及应用型人才培养的需要,编者结合多年的教学经验和生产实践经验,并吸取了近年来先进教学方法,本着“实际、实用、实践”的原则,编写了本书。本书选用了技术先进、占市场份额最大的FANUC(法那科)、SIEMENS(西门子)以及国产华中(HNC?21/22M)系统的数控铣床与加工中心为背景,系统讲述了数控铣床与加工中心的基本知识、数控加工工艺、数控基本编程指令、宏程序、数控机床操作以及典型零件数控加工实训课题。本书尽可能使理论教学与实操同步,在教学顺序上相互衔接,配合大量例题,由浅入深,由易到难,力求使学生能够较好地学习和巩固编程与实操知识,提高编程技术和实操技能,使学习者达到中、高级数控专业技能型人才的水平。在编程实践和应用方面,采用课题形式,理论与实践相结合,把数控加工工艺知识融入编程中。课题中融合了典型零件加工编程、刀具的选择、切削用量的选择、有关理论计算、操作步骤及注意事项,力求前后知识融会贯通。最后配合数控加工知识和技能考核模拟题,使学生得到综合的训练。因此该教材既具有较强的理论性、实践性,又具有较强的综合性。教材力求把学习理论知识和培养实践能力有机结合起来,培养学生的实际操作和应用能力。本书可作为高等职业院校、中等职业学校、成人院校数控技术应用专业、机电专业、模具专业的教材,也可作为数控铣床及加工中心编程与操作培训教材,并可供机械制造业有关工程技术人员参考。本书不足之处,敬请读者批评指正。 上传我的文档
 下载
 收藏
该文档贡献者很忙,什么也没留下。
 下载此文档
正在努力加载中...
数控铣床加工中心编程与操作(FANUC系统) 4-2 下载
下载积分:400
内容提示:数控铣床加工中心编程与操作(FANUC系统) 4-2 下载
文档格式:PPT|
浏览次数:2|
上传日期: 02:00:05|
文档星级:
全文阅读已结束,如果下载本文需要使用
 400 积分
下载此文档
该用户还上传了这些文档
数控铣床加工中心编程与操作(FANUC系统) 4-2 下载
官方公共微信半径补偿的基本概念
图1 加工中的刀具半径补偿
在轮廓加工过程中,由于刀具总有一定的半径(如铣刀半径或线切割机的钼丝半径等), 刀具中心的运动轨迹与所需加工零件的实际轮廓并不重合。如在图1中,粗实线为所需加工的零件轮廓,点划线为刀具中心轨迹。由图可见在进行内轮廓加工时,刀具中心偏离零件的内轮廓表面一个刀具半径值。在进行外轮廓加工时,刀具中心又偏离零件的外轮廓表面一个刀具半径值。这种偏移,称为刀具半径补偿。
采用刀具半径补偿的作用和意义数控机床一般都具备刀具半径补偿的功能。在加工中,使用数控系统的刀具半径补偿功能,就能避开数控编程过程中的繁琐计算,而只需计算出刀具中心轨迹的起始点坐标值就可。同时,利用刀具半径补偿功能,还可以实现同一程序的粗、精加工以及同一程序的阴阳模具加工等功能。
刀具半径补偿指令的使用方式根据ISO 标准规定,当刀具中心轨迹在编程轨迹前进方向的左边时,称为左刀补,用G41表示;刀具中心轨迹在编程轨迹前进方向的右边时,称为右刀补,用G42表示;注销刀具半径补偿时用G40表示。
2 刀具半径补偿过程
刀具半径补偿建立:当输入BS缓冲器的程序段包含有G41/G42命令时,系统认为此时已进入刀补建立状态。当以下条件成立时,加工中心以移动坐标轴的形式开始补偿动作。
有G41或G42被指定;
在补偿平面内有轴的移动;
指定了一个补偿号或已经指定一个补偿号但不能是D00;
偏置(补偿)平面被指定或已经被指定;
G00或G01模式有效。
补偿模式:在刀具补偿进行期间,刀具中心轨迹始终偏离编程轨迹一个刀具半径值的距离。此时半径补偿在G00、G01、G02、G03情况下均有效。
取消补偿:使用G40指令消去程序段偏置值,使刀具撤离工件,回到起始位置,从而使刀具中心与偏程轨迹重合。当以下两种情况之一发生时加工中心补偿模式被取消。①给出G40同时要有补偿平面内坐标轴移动。②刀具补偿号为D00。
3 刀具半径补偿在加工中心中的应用
有了刀具半径自动补偿功能,除可免去刀心轨迹的人工计算外,还可利用同一加工程序去完成粗、精加工及阴阳模具加工等。
图2 G18指令的使用
不同平面内的半径补偿刀具半径补偿用G17、G18、G19命令在被选择的工作平面内进行补偿。即当G18命令执行后,刀具半径补偿仅影响X、Z移动,而对Y轴没有作用。铣削如图2所示圆柱面,使用刀具是半径为10mm的球形立铣刀。编程控制点有两个,即刀尖、球心,这里使用球心。O0001N1 GX60.0Y0S1000M03;N2 Z0;N3 G91G01 G41X-20.0D01 F100;N4 G02X-80.0I40.0;N5 G40GG0lX20.0;┇┇N22vG90G00Z100.0;N23vX0 Y0M05;N24 M30;
实现同一程序的粗、精加工:刀具半径补偿除方便编程外,还可改变补偿大小的方法以用实现同一程序的粗精加工。粗加工刀具补偿量=刀具半径+精加工余量,精加工刀具补偿量=刀具半径+修正量
实现同一程序的阴阳模具加工
图3 内、外两种型面的加工
在加工同一公称尺寸的内、外两种型面时,可分别调用G41、G42指令,利用同一程序(G41G42互换)完成内、外两种型面的加工。如图3。
4 使用刀具半径补偿时常见的问题
半径补偿时的过切问题
无被选择的工作平面内的移动指令:当刀具半径补偿指令发出时,第一段程序先被读入BS,在BS中算得的第一段编程轨迹被送到CS暂存后,又将第二段程序读入BS,算出第二段的编程轨迹。接着对第一和第二两段的编程轨迹的连接方式进行判别。根据判别结果,再对CS中的第一段编程轨迹作相应的修正。修正结束后,顺序地将修正后的第一段编程轨迹由CS 送AS第二段编程轨迹由BS送入CS。随后,由CPU将AS中的内容送到OS进行插补运算,运算结果送伺服装置予以执行。如接下的两个程序段在被选择的工作平面内无移动指令,机床无法判断刀具半径补偿的方向,此时机床不发出报警信号,补偿继续进行,只是补偿的起始点发生变化,从而导致工件发生过切现象。例,如图4。
图4 半径补偿中的过切现象
O0002N1 G90G54G17 G00X0Y0S2000M03N2 Z100.0N3 G41 X40.0Y10.0D01
连续两句Z 轴移动
N5 G01Z-10.0F100
而没有XY 轴移动
N6Y100.0N7X100.0N8Y40.0N9X20.0N10G00Z100.0N11G40X0Y0M05N12M30
刀具补偿值大于被加工部分内圆弧半径:当零件上的圆弧半径小于刀具半径补偿值时,向圆弧、圆心方向的半径补偿将会导致过切,这时程序运行到该程序段时,机床将发出报警并停止在将要过切程序段的起始点上,如图5所示。
图5 不停机导致过切
图6 不停机导致过切
被铣削部分的槽底宽小于刀具直径:当刀具半径补偿使刀具中心向编程路径反方向运动,将会导致过切。此时机床将会报警并停留在该程序段的起始点,如图6 所示。
G40 执行前改变补偿号刀具半径补偿号要在刀具补偿取消后才能改变,如果在G40下变换补偿号,当前程序段的目的点的补偿量将按照新的给定值,而当前程序段开始点补偿量则不变,从而可能导致欠切削或过切。
在G02、G03模式下取消刀具补偿刀具补偿必须在G00、G01模式下取消在G02、G03模式下取消刀具补偿时,系统将发出报警。
M96模式与M97模式在圆角过渡模式M96下,用G41或G42进行刀具半径补偿时,如果相邻程序轨迹交角为180&或更大,刀具将以圆弧插补方式绕着交点回转。相反在交角过渡模式M97下,刀具中心将运动至二相邻刀心轨迹的点而不是进行圆弧插补。当加工零件上的阶台高度比刀具半径小时,用M96模式将会引起过切,如用M97模式则可以顺利通过,如图7 所示。
当数控机床具有刀具半径补偿功能时会极大方便计算和编程,但在使用此项功能时应注意机床的硬件条件以及工件轮廓几何要素的过渡处的处理,以避免产生欠切削和过切等问题,提高工件的加工精度。(编辑:珍珠)
&&&&&&&&如果您有模具设计行业、企业相关文库稿件发表,或进行资讯合作,欢迎联系本网编辑部,
邮箱投稿:,我要投稿
更多相关信息
发表评论共有位网友发表了评论
版权与免责声明:
①凡本网注明"来源:模具联盟网"的所有作品,版权均属于模具联盟网,转载请必须注明模具联盟网,违反者本网将追究相关法律责任。
②本网转载并注明自其它来源的作品,目的在于传递更多信息,并不代表本网赞同其观点或证实其内容的真实性,不承担此类作品侵权行为的直接责任及连带责任。其他媒体、网站或个人从本网转载时,必须保留本网注明的作品来源,并自负版权等法律责任。
③如涉及作品内容、版权等问题,请在作品发表之日起一周内与本网联系,否则视为放弃相关权利。
主办:青华工作室出版:中国模具研究中心
在北京钢材圈里

我要回帖

更多关于 发那科加工中心编程 的文章

 

随机推荐